overview
The docs should prove the styling flexibility, not just say it.
Hiraki is for teams that want accessible drawer behavior without inheriting a visual system. The library handles semantics, gestures, snap points, dismissal, and focus management. Your product still owns the final look.
accessiblebehavior-firstbring your own stylesredesignable
Accessible behavior
ARIA dialog semantics, focus trapping, Escape dismissal, overlay dismissal, and scroll locking belong in the library.
Styling
Color, radius, type, spacing, motion, and personality stay inside the consuming app.
Proof over promise
The docs below show the same primitive rendered in two very different Tailwind styles, and both are built from the actual package.
accessiblefocus trapsnap pointsbehavior-firstbring your own stylesredesignable